    Andrew C.

    Had came here on a Wednesday night to pick up some late night skewers. CASH ONLY ! Yelp hours says its open from 5pm til 1am. Had attempted to come here night before around 1245A but they had already left. Apparently according to random people i asked, they had saw the cart maybe an hour earlier. Had also tried to come here around 5pm another day and they weren't here yet (saw them maybe an hour later) The cart is located on the Northeast corner of Prince St and 39th Ave, across from 39 King's Cafe and diagnonally across from Nan Xiang Xiao Long Bao, in the corner of a parking area. Fat Ni's pricing is probably the "most expensive" of the carts we came across, at an average of $2/skewer. 2 people worked the cart. 1 took orders while 1 cooked which made it more "streamlined" than other carts. Had wished to come back here to try other items but they are pretty elusive with their hours so I wasn't able to try them again. Overall though, they are decent. Flavors/seasoning are between carts are fairly similar anyway. I had tried 5x lamb, 2 chicken gizzard, 1 chicken heart, 2 pork intestine. All were pretty good. First time having grilled pork intestine like this. Decent. Unsure if i'd get it again. Maybe if i'm craving pork intestine. Nothing wrong with it but i rather have it deep fried or stir fried hehe. Lamb was tender and flavorful. Chicken gizzard and heart had its "crunchy" unique characteristics as usual. All yummy.

    Nicole N.

    On the corner of 39th Ave and Prince St in Downtown Flushing, you will find a well staffed chinese BBQ skewer cart. Each skewer is around $1.75 (cash only, no tax) and they are operating late into the night. The fish tofu and squid skewers were delicious and perfectly seasoned with spices. Usually people order at least 5 skewers per person because there is a small amount of meat/vegetable compared to other skewer carts.

    Tiffanii C.

    I came here on recommendation of the staff from Apollo Bakery as I wanted to find a good Chinese BBQ stand. They said that this place is their go to for good skewers and I can see why! I got their Beef, Chicken, and Chive skewers (nothing like a well-balanced ish meal right?). I thoroughly enjoyed all the skewers I got. For the Beef and Chicken ones, the meat was tender and juicy from the fat and the seasonings they put on the skewers were in great proportions. Super flavorful and can really taste the cumin, one of my all time favorite Chinese seasonings! The Chive was perfectly grilled as well and the seasonings they put on there also made it wonderfully tasty. Overall, I'd definitely come back here if I'm ever in the area (which will definitely be often)!
